www.gusucode.com > 一个JSP商品管理系统源码程序 > 一个JSP商品管理系统/MobileMGR/MobileMGR/WebRoot/imis_mate/js/MaterialMaintainTable.js
// JavaScript Document function checkValue() { var maintainFee = document.form1.maintainFee.value; if (maintainFee!=""){ var regp = /\d{1,9}\.?\d{0,2}$/; if (maintainFee.match(regp) == null) { document.form1.maintainFee.focus(); alert("输入维修费用格式错误!使用“0.00”格式"); return false; } } var materialTypeNo = document.form1.materialTypeNo.value; if(materialTypeNo=="") { window.alert("输入物品类型。"); document.form1.materialTypeNo.focus(); return false; } var maintainDate = document.form1.maintainDate.value; if(maintainDate=="") { window.alert("输入物品维修日期。"); document.form1.maintainDate.focus(); return false; } var maintainCount = document.form1.maintainCount.value; if (maintainCount!=""){ var regp =/^\d{1,7}$/; if (maintainCount.match(regp) == null) { document.form1.maintainCount.focus(); alert("输入维修数量格式错误!"); return false; } } if(maintainCount=="") { window.alert("输入物品维修数量。"); document.form1.maintainCount.focus(); return false; } var materialName = document.form1.materialName.value; if(materialName=="") { window.alert("输入物品名称。"); document.form1.materialName.focus(); return false; } if (materialName.length > 50){ window.alert("输入物品名称长度超出,限定为25个中文字符或者50个英文字符。"); document.form1.materialName.focus(); return false; } var maModel = document.form1.maModel.value; if (maModel.length > 50){ window.alert("输入型号长度超出,限定为25个中文字符或者50个英文字符。"); document.form1.maModel.focus(); return false; }var maBrand = document.form1.maBrand.value; if (maBrand.length > 50){ window.alert("输入品牌长度超出,限定为25个中文字符或者50个英文字符。"); document.form1.maBrand.focus(); return false; }var maMadeIn = document.form1.maMadeIn.value; if (maMadeIn.length > 50){ window.alert("输入产地长度超出,限定为25个中文字符或者50个英文字符。"); document.form1.maMadeIn.focus(); return false; } var userCode = document.form1.userCode.value; if (userCode.length > 30){ window.alert("输入维修人长度超出,限定为15个中文字符或者30个英文字符。"); document.form1.userCode.focus(); return false; } var managerBy = document.form1.managerBy.value; if (managerBy.length > 30){ window.alert("输入责任人长度超出,限定为15个中文字符或者30个英文字符。"); document.form1.managerBy.focus(); return false; } var useBy = document.form1.useBy.value; if (useBy.length > 30){ window.alert("输入使用人长度超出,限定为15个中文字符或者30个英文字符。"); document.form1.useBy.focus(); return false; } var roomNu = document.form1.roomNu.value; if (roomNu.length > 30){ window.alert("输入放置位置房间长度超出,限定为15个中文字符或者30个英文字符。"); document.form1.roomNu.focus(); return false; } var buildingNu = document.form1.buildingNu.value; if (buildingNu.length > 30){ window.alert("输入建筑物代号长度超出,限定为15个中文字符或者30个英文字符。"); document.form1.buildingNu.focus(); return false; } var maintainCause = document.form1.maintainCause.value; if (maintainCause.length > 100){ window.alert("输入维修原因长度超出,限定为50个中文字符或者100个英文字符。"); document.form1.maintainCause.focus(); return false; } var remark = document.form1.remark.value; if (remark.length > 100){ window.alert("输入摘要长度超出,限定为50个中文字符或者100个英文字符。"); document.form1.remark.focus(); return false; } return true; }